
Dr Stefan Toepfer has contributed to WGRZ-TV’s The Outdoors programme on Invasive Species by sharing his expertise on ragweed – the invasive species that is a nightmare for millions of hay fever sufferers across Europe.
Dr Toepfer was invited to take part in the show for the Buffalo, New York-based, TV station after its producer saw a story on CABI.org where Stefan is co-supervising a PhD student researching a biological control agent for ragweed.
You can see the piece, which turns the spotlight on invasive species ‘exported’ from America to Europe, on WGRZ-TV’s YouTube channel.
